Get SupportIDrive Update Failed error occurs when the IDrive application cannot complete the update process successfully. This issue may prevent users from installing the latest version of the software, accessing new features, or receiving important security improvements.
IDrive updates are important because they improve application performance, fix known issues, enhance compatibility, and provide better backup reliability. When an update fails, it is usually related to internet connectivity, insufficient permissions, outdated software files, or security settings on the device.
Several factors can cause IDrive update problems. Understanding the cause can help you apply the correct troubleshooting steps.
Follow these troubleshooting steps to resolve IDrive update problems:
A stable internet connection is required to download and install IDrive updates. If your connection is slow or interrupted, the update process may fail. Restart your router or switch to another network before trying the update again.
Sometimes IDrive cannot update because it does not have enough system permissions. Running the application as an administrator can allow the updater to access required files and complete the installation process.
Firewall programs and antivirus software may block IDrive update files because they monitor application changes. Temporarily disabling these security settings can help identify whether they are causing the update failure.
Insufficient storage space can prevent IDrive from downloading or installing update files. Remove unnecessary files and ensure your device has enough available storage before attempting the update.
If the update continues to fail, reinstalling the IDrive application can help replace damaged or outdated program files. Remove the existing installation, download the latest version, and complete a fresh installation.
